Aberdeen Police investigating apparent murder of 63-year old man

ABERDEEN -  Aberdeen Police have one person in custody in connection to the apparent murder of a 63-year old man, found deceased on Saturday.  Police report that a woman called   9-1-1 just before 5 a.m.  Arriving officers found the deceased man inside the home in the 1400 block of Cherry Street.

The female caller was the only other person inside the home, police said.  A search warrant was obtained and executed by police.  The woman, a 45-year old Aberdeen resident, was arrested at the scene and booked into the Aberdeen jail on a charge of Second Degree Homicide.

The Grays Harbor County Coroner's office will perform an autopsy on the victim.  The man's identification and cause of death will be released  by the coroner pending notification of his family.
